SOME STUDIES ON THE HYDRAULIC AND OTHER RELATED PROPERTIES OF CALCIUM ALUMINATES AT DIFFERENT CURING TEMPERATURES SIMULATING INDIAN CLIMATIC CONDITIONS

摘要

In the present study, synthetically prepared Calcium aluminates such as CA, CA_2 and C_12A_7 (C=CaO, A=Al_2O_3) were subjected to hydration for different periods of time. The nature of hydration reaction and the heat energy associated with interconversion of hydrated compounds has been studied utilizing DSC technique. The hydrated compounds formed & their morphology were confirmed by TG-DTA-DTG, XRD and SEM studies. The activation energy values for dehydration of hydrated compounds were determined using Kissinger Plot and the results revealed that thermal stability of hydrated CA & CA_2 are very close to each other and higher than that of hydrated C_12A_7.
